Montgomery College: Semester-Long Regular Courses

Students aged 60 years and older may be eligible for a tuition waiver! Seniors who wish to take advantage of the tuition waiver must register during the Senior Registration period (the final three days of registration).

Waiver requirements:

  • You will still be responsible for paying the required fees.
  • Please check the Important Dates and Deadlines page for the date the waiver goes into effect. If you register before this date, you will be responsible for full tuition and fees.
  • Waivers are given on a space-available basis.
